Understanding CrossChain Transactions

Crosschain transactions refer to the ability to transfer assets across different blockchain networks. This feature is crucial for a more interconnected crypto ecosystem, allowing users to exchange assets without the need for an intermediary. ImToken supports several popular chains, making it a versatile tool in the hands of crypto enthusiasts.

  • The Concept of Batch Operations

    Batch operations, in the context of cryptocurrency transactions, refer to the ability to execute multiple transactions in a single operation. This feature can greatly enhance productivity and efficiency, especially for users who handle multiple assets.

    Why Consider Batch Operations for CrossChain Transactions?

  • Time Efficiency: Executing multiple transactions at once saves valuable time compared to processing each transaction individually.
  • Reduced Fees: Some platforms may offer lower fees for batch processing compared to handling individual transactions.
  • Simplified Processes: Managing multiple transactions as a single operation can simplify the user experience, making it easier to track and manage assets.
  • Can You BatchOperate CrossChain Transactions in imToken?imtoken下载?

    Currently, imToken does not officially support batch operations for crosschain transactions. Each transaction must be processed individually, which can be cumbersome for users wanting to transfer multiple assets. However, there are several strategies that users can employ to streamline their transaction processes.

    Common Queries About imToken CrossChain Transactions

  • What types of cryptocurrencies does imToken support for crosschain transactions?
  • ImToken supports several major cryptocurrencies, including Ethereum (ETH), Bitcoin (BTC), and a variety of ERC20 tokens. This wide range allows users to participate in crosschain transactions easily.

  • How secure are crosschain transactions on imToken?
  • ImToken employs various security protocols to ensure the safety of transactions, including private key encryption and a usercontrolled wallet. However, the security of crosschain transactions also depends on the underlying blockchain’s security.

  • Are there any limitations to crosschain transactions on imToken?
  • Yes, limitations can include transaction time delays, fees associated with Ethereum’s gas fees, and potential compatibility issues with less popular blockchains. Users should familiarize themselves with these aspects to manage expectations.

  • Can I revert a crosschain transaction if I make an error?
  • Once a transaction is confirmed on the blockchain, it cannot be undone. Users should doublecheck transaction details before execution to avoid mistakes.

  • How can I track my crosschain transactions on imToken?
  • ImToken provides transaction history within the app, allowing users to review pending and completed transactions. For deeper analysis, external blockchain explorers can be used depending on the blockchain in question.

  • What should I do if I experience transaction errors on imToken?
  • If you encounter issues during transactions, it is advisable to check the transaction status in the app first. If the problem persists, consulting imToken's support resources or community forums can provide solutions.
